JOB DESCRIPTION:
Operations Manager reports directly to the Branch Manager
Lead, develop, and manage field personnel
Scheduling of daily jobs, allocation of equipment, and field equipment
Develop best practices for improving operational efficiencies and job profitability
Provide support to the Barnhart sales team
Effectively manage labor and equipment in the daily operation to comply with company goals in the areas of: DOT, SOP, Qual Cards, Personal injury, equipment and property loss, safety audits, equipment maintenance, safety and post job reviews
Track and assign all training for Field Personnel
Operations Coordinator will be part of the team that ensures that the branches meet or exceed all of the criteria set out in the Barnhart monthly report card.
Preferred Qualifications:
~5-10 years of industrial experience, rigging and/or power generation experience is a plus
~ An ability to multi-task and exhibit flexibility in job duties
~ Excellent communication skills and the ability to coach others
~ Strong computer skills with a superior working knowledge of MS Office Products
~ An ability to train, formally and informally, through mentoring and success-based delegation
~ Must pass drug test, fit for duty and background check
~ College degree preferred
